In a single week, eight security vendors announced platforms built around autonomous AI agents capable of investigating threats, remediating vulnerabilities, and enforcing policy without waiting for human instruction. The announcements, spanning SOC operations, application security, Kubernetes infrastructure, and employee access, signal not an incremental upgrade but a philosophical reorientation: the machine moves first, and the human verifies after. Regulatory pressure from frameworks like the EU's Cyber Resilience Act is accelerating this shift, embedding governance directly into automation

Geopolitical Impact
Major cybersecurity vendors are rapidly deploying AI agents across enterprise security infrastructure, representing a significant shift toward autonomous threat response and compliance automation with potential global security standardization implications.
Consolidation of security market power among major vendors (Fortinet, Barracuda, Legit Security) who control AI-driven threat response; EU regulatory framework (Cyber Resilience Act) is driving global security standards; vendors embedding AI agents create dependency relationships with enterprises, shifting control of incident response from human analysts to proprietary AI systems.
Similar to the shift from manual to automated threat detection in the 2010s; parallels the regulatory-driven standardization seen with GDPR implementation, where EU regulations became de facto global standards.
Economic Lens
Enterprise cybersecurity vendors are rapidly commercializing AI agents for SOC, AppSec, and infrastructure, signaling strong market demand and potential margin expansion through automation-driven efficiency gains.
Organizations will face increased pressure to adopt AI-augmented security platforms, potentially raising cybersecurity spending but reducing operational costs through automation; smaller enterprises may face higher barriers to entry due to platform consolidation.
EU Cyber Resilience Act compliance tools indicate regulatory frameworks are driving vendor innovation; expect increased government scrutiny of AI agent decision-making in critical security functions and potential liability frameworks for autonomous security actions.
